BUG: Retention Change Not Updated on Cleanup Task (157594)
The information in this article applies to:
- Microsoft SQL Server 4.2x
- Microsoft SQL Server 6.0
- Microsoft SQL Server 6.5
This article was previously published under Q157594
BUG #: 16028 (SQLBUG_65)
15651 (SQLBUG_60)
SYMPTOMS
When the retention period for a replication is changed, the replication
cleanup task still holds the old retention value.
CAUSE
The new retention value is not passed to sp_updatetask.
WORKAROUND
Whenever the retention period is changed, manually modify the appropriate
task and update the retention value for its cleanup task.
STATUS
Microsoft has confirmed this to be a problem in SQL Server versions 4.2x,
6.0, and 6.5. We are researching this problem and will post new information
here in the Microsoft Knowledge Base as it becomes available.
